Sweetie on the Beach
I love this one. It is of my husband reading one early evening on Galveston beach. Behind him is some sand that was heaped up on riprap at the base of the seawall. I like the looseness of the brushstrokes in this one and the muted colors. My husband doesn't like it -- can it be that people don't like paintings of themselves the same way they don't like photos of themselves? (No. 44, 6x6", on Gessobord, Oct. 8, 2012)
